Eddie Howe’s Newcastle United are reportedly confident that James Maddison will choose them over Mikel Arteta’s Arsenal.
Football Transfers are reporting this afternoon that Newcastle United are confident that Leicester City attacking midfielder James Maddison will pick them over Arsenal in the summer transfer window.
The report has claimed that Newcastle believe “that a combination of more game time and more money than the 26-year-old might get at Arsenal” will convince him to move to St. James’ Park and not to the Emirates Stadium.
The Mirror reported last month that Arsenal are keen on Maddison, described as “perfect” by talkSPORT pundit and Rangers legend Ally McCoist in March.
